North Mountain Blade 2418-CU-G-5 Chop – 3.5" Copper-Clad Steel Tanto Folding Knife

The North Mountain Blade 2418-CU-G-5 is a heavy-duty tactical EDC folding knife featuring a 3.5" in-house forged 5-layer copper-clad steel tanto blade and a solid copper grid-pattern handle. As the latest evolution of the "Chop" platform, the 2418-CU-G-5 is a complete redesign of the 2406 focused on strength, ambidextrous use, and premium craftsmanship. North Mountain Blade 2418-CU-G-5 Specifications

Specification Detail
Brand North Mountain Blade
Model 2418 Chop
SKU 2418-CU-G-5
Overall Length 8.0" (203mm)
Blade Length 3.5" (89mm)
Handle Length 4.5" (114mm)
Blade Thickness 0.123" (3.1mm)
Blade Steel In-house Forged 5-Layer Copper-Clad Steel
Blade Style Tanto
Handle Material Copper (Grid Pattern)
Lock Type Crossbar Lock
Weight 194g (6.84 oz)
Knife Type Folding Knife
